quote: Step Ten: Continued to take personal inventory and when we were wrong promptly admitted it.
"Our inventory enables us to settle with the past. When this is done, we are really able to leave it behind us. When our inventory is carefully taken, and we have made peace with ourselves, the conviction follows that tomorrow's challenges can be met as they come."
Twelve Steps and Twelve Traditions, pg. 89
This is an in today program. Anything that I act out as a result of my past, I need to look at and change in today. It was important for me to address old patterns and behaviors to see what no longer served me in good stead in today. When I go to a meeting and this Step is discussed, it always seems as though I need to be more vigilant. This Step reminds me that for every finger I point at someone else, I have three pointing back at me.
As the 12 & 12 says, "When I find fault in another, there is something being reflected from within me." This was not easy to accept. It was too easy to play the blame game and not take responsibility for my own thoughts and actions.
